Some of the top Indian shuttlers will continue their action in 2024 when they take court for the 42nd edition of Indonesia Open, which is scheduled to take place at the Istora Gelora Bung Karno in Jakarta, Indonesia, starting from Tuesday (June 4).
The Indonesia Open 2024 will start with the first round matches on June 4 and June 5 followed by the second round, quarterfinals, semifinal on the subsequent days from June 6 to June 8, and the badminton tournament will conclude with the finals on Sunday (June 9).

A total of 64 singles players and 96 doubles teams from across the globe, including as many as 6 singles players and 4 doubles pairs from India will compete at the BWF World Tour Super 1000 event.
PV Sindhu, Lakshya Sen, Priyanshu Rajawat, Akarshi Kashyap and HS Prannoy will be among the singles shuttlers representing India at the Indonesia Open 2024. Tanisha Crasto-Ashwini Ponnappa and Treesa Jolly Gayatri Gopichand will be among the doubles from the country.

The action from the courts 1 and 2 will be telecast live in India via Sports 18-1 HD and Sports 18-3 SD channels, the Indonesia Open 2024 live streaming will be available via the JioCinema app. Fans can also watch the action of the remaining courts on BWF's Official YouTube channel BWF TV.
